> > The arts use flag has been masked, that why it is parenthesised. |
16 |
> > |
17 |
> > % grep arts /usr/portage/profiles/base/use.mask |
18 |
> > # Mask USE arts. Deprecated. Remove this entry when kdelibs-3 is out of |
19 |
> > tree. |
20 |
> > arts |
21 |
> > |
22 |
> > You need to add -arts to /etc/portage/profile/use.mask |

> Anyway, I don't have that file so do I just create it? Is it sort of |
36 |
> like a package.unmask file? |
37 |
|
38 |
Yes. It's your locally defined USE flag mask, identical in purpose to the one |
39 |
the devs place into your profile |
